South East Melbourne Phoenix is happy to announce that Pepperstone have re-committed as Major Partners for NBL23.
Pepperstone will take prime branding position on the lower back of the jerseys, as well as on the team polo sleeves.
They will once again be the naming rights for Phoenix’s corporate hospitality, ‘Pepperstone Phoenix Nest’ at home games.

“It’s great to have Pepperstone back on board for another season,” said Phoenix CEO Tommy Greer. “To have them feature on our jerseys this season, shows the growth and commitment of our partnership together.”
"We're thrilled to continue our partnership with the SE Melbourne Phoenix for another season. The NBL is an incredibly strong and exciting competition going from strength to strength, made more evident just recently with one of its teams beating another, in the NBA. At Pepperstone, we pride ourselves on being courageous in collaboration, a philosophy we share with Phoenix. As they strive to be #1 on the courts in one of the toughest basketball leagues in the world, we strive to be #1 in bringing the world's financial markets to our clients." Tony Gruebner, Chief Marketing Officer, Pepperstone.
